How We Repair Subfloor Water Damage

Our team’s process for subfloor water damage repair is designed to get your home back to normal as quickly and efficiently as possible. We understand that every minute counts, and that’s why we focus on rapid response times and a thorough, effective solution. Here’s a step-by-step overview of our process:

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our team begins by assessing the extent of the damage and identifying the source of the water leak. We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the structural integrity of your subfloor.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Next, we extract the water from the affected area using specialized equipment, such as wet/dry vacuums and dehumidifiers. We then use dr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from the subfloor and surrounding areas.

Step 3: Subfloor Repair and Replacement

Once the area is dry, we repair or replace any damaged subflooring, ensuring a secure and stable foundation for your home.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to sanitize and disinfect the affected area,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for your family.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Finally, we conduct a thorough inspection to ensure the repair is complete and the area is clean and safe. We also provide a final cleaning of the affected area to ensure your home is back to normal.

Subfloor Water Damage Repair Cost in Harrisville, UT

The cost of subfloor water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Harrisville, UT. Here are some estimated price ranges for common subfloor water damage repair services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and drying time.
Subfloor Repair and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used, and labor costs.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and cleaning solutions.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of cleaning required.

Common Questions About Subfloor Water Damage Repair

Q: What causes subfloor water damage?

A: Subfloor water damage is often caused by hidden moisture, such as leaks behind walls or under flooring, or by flooding from external sources like storms or burst pipes. Our team uses specialized equipment to detect and repair hidden moisture, ensuring a thorough and effective solution.
